Electric Blankets Market Size and Share:

The global electric blankets market size was valued at USD 1.21 Billion in 2025. Looking forward, IMARC Group estimates the market to reach USD 2.14 Billion by 2034, exhibiting a CAGR of 5.98% from 2026-2034. North America currently dominates the market, holding a market share of 35.2% in 2025. The region benefits from extensive cold weather conditions across major population centers, growing consumer preference for energy-efficient home heating alternatives over conventional central heating systems, robust residential adoption of thermostat-controlled electric warming products, increasing uptake of smart home-compatible warming devices, and sustained manufacturer investment in product safety and advanced comfort innovations, all of which collectively reinforce the electric blanket market share.

The global electric blanket market is driven by a confluence of demographic, climatic, and lifestyle-related factors that are collectively expanding consumer demand. Rising awareness of energy-efficient home heating solutions has positioned electric blankets as a cost-effective substitute for whole-room central heating systems, particularly in colder regions. Simultaneously, advancements in product technology, including dual-temperature controls, automatic shut-off mechanisms, and machine-washable heating elements, are enhancing product appeal across diverse consumer groups. The growing trend of premiumization in home comfort products, alongside an increase in residential construction activity in emerging economies, is further supporting the electric blanket market growth. Additionally, the shift toward sustainable and energy-conscious living continues to encourage households to adopt localized heating products.

The United States has emerged as a major region in the electric blanket market owing to many factors. The country’s diverse climate zones, particularly in the northern and midwestern states where winters are prolonged and severe, drive substantial residential demand for personal warming solutions. American consumers demonstrate a well-established preference for home comfort products that combine convenience with advanced functionality, and electric blankets fit this profile given their portability, ease of use, and programmable settings. As per sources, in October 2025, the U.S. Energy Information Administration reported that space heating accounts for nearly 42% of total residential energy consumption in American households, highlighting the importance of efficient supplemental heating solutions. Federal and state energy efficiency initiatives have further encouraged consumers to explore alternatives to energy-intensive central heating, elevating interest in electric blankets as a supplementary warming solution.

Electric Blankets Market Trends:

Growing Adoption of Smart and Connected Heating Products

The increasing integration of smart home technology into everyday appliances has significantly transformed the electric blanket landscape. Modern consumers seek products that can be seamlessly controlled via smartphone applications, voice-activated assistants, and automated home systems. This demand for connectivity is prompting manufacturers to embed wireless communication modules into electric blanket designs, enabling remote temperature adjustments and personalized usage scheduling throughout the day and night. As per sources, Eight Sleep introduced the Pod 3 smart sleep system featuring app-controlled temperature regulation, Wi-Fi connectivity, and sensor-based monitoring that adjusts sleep temperature automatically based on user data. The appeal of smart electric blankets extends beyond mere convenience, as connected systems allow users to pre-warm beds, set wake-up temperatures, and monitor energy consumption in real time.

Rising Focus on Health and Therapeutic Warming Solutions

The growing recognition of the therapeutic and health benefits associated with regulated thermal comfort is emerging as a significant driver for the electric blanket market. Healthcare professionals and wellness practitioners have begun incorporating thermotherapy principles into lifestyle recommendations, further legitimizing the use of electric blankets as a functional wellness product. For example, the Arthritis Foundation highlighted that heat therapy, including heated pads and warm compresses, can help relax muscles, improve blood circulation, and reduce joint stiffness in individuals with arthritis and fibromyalgia. The electric blanket market outlook is particularly positive as manufacturers respond by developing clinically endorsed heating products with precision temperature zones, auto shut-off timers, and hypoallergenic materials.

Expanding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Product Innovation

The increasing emphasis on environmental responsibility across global consumer markets is driving significant innovation within the electric blanket industry. Manufacturers are responding to the growing preference for eco-friendly products by adopting sustainable materials such as recycled polyester fibers, organic cotton blends, and biodegradable packaging in their production processes. The transition toward greener manufacturing practices is being further accelerated by regulatory standards in key markets that mandate reduced carbon footprints in textile production. According to reports, the European Commission adopted the EU Strategy for Sustainable and Circular Textiles, aiming to ensure that textile products sold in the European Union are more durable, recyclable, and largely made from recycled fibers by 2030. The electric blanket market forecast remains optimistic as sustainability-driven product lines continue to gain consumer and retail acceptance globally.

Analysis by Type:

  • Electric Under Blankets
  • Electric Over Blankets

Electric under blankets holds 55.3% of the market share, these blankets, also referred to as underblankets or heated mattress pads, are placed beneath the bed sheets directly on top of the mattress, providing a warm sleeping surface that can be pre-heated before use. This category is widely favored for its ability to distribute heat evenly across the entire sleeping area, ensuring consistent warmth from below rather than from above. The underlying placement allows for more efficient heat retention and reduces the amount of energy required to maintain a comfortable sleeping temperature throughout the night. Growing interest in sleep quality and bedroom comfort has elevated the status of electric under blankets as a preferred category among consumers seeking a more controlled and personalized sleep environment. The evolving electric blanket market trends reflect strong consumer affinity for under-blanket formats, as they offer a discreet, flat profile that does not interfere with bedding aesthetics. Manufacturers continue to innovate within this category by introducing dual-zone heating, hypoallergenic materials, and washable designs.

Analysis by Material:

  • Wool
  • Cotton
  • Polyester
  • Acrylic
  • Others

Currently, polyester is the most popular material used in the manufacture of electric blankets, with a market share of 45.3%, as it has excellent thermal retention capabilities and can withstand harsh weather conditions. This synthetic material can retain warmth while keeping water absorption to a minimum, making it ideal for the manufacture of electric blankets. This material has excellent thermal retention capabilities while ensuring that the blankets remain lightweight to provide maximum comfort to users. In addition, polyester blankets remain soft and retain their shapes despite repeated washing, which is essential to ensure that the blankets remain hygienic. The fact that polyester is a cost-effective material ensures that the blankets remain affordable to a wide number of people without compromising on quality. In addition, the ability to manufacture ultra-fine microfiber has ensured that the material meets the needs of modern consumers who seek high-quality blankets that can provide maximum comfort during the cold winter months. The fact that polyester can be used to manufacture a wide range of designs ensures that the blankets can be made to appear unique to individual tastes while providing maximum comfort to users.

North America, accounting for 35.2% of the share, maintaining the leading position in the market. The region’s dominance is underpinned by a large consumer base residing in climates with prolonged and cold winter seasons, particularly across the northern and midwestern United States and significant portions of Canada. High disposable incomes and strong consumer spending on home comfort products have contributed to robust demand for both standard and premium electric blanket offerings. The well-established retail infrastructure in North America, encompassing specialty stores, department stores, and online platforms, facilitates convenient consumer access to a diverse range of electric blanket products throughout the year. Furthermore, the region benefits from heightened awareness of energy conservation, which has encouraged consumers to replace energy-intensive heating systems with targeted electric warming solutions. Continued product innovations, including advanced safety mechanisms, customizable temperature zones, and improved fabric quality, along with growing consumer inclination toward smart home integration, further reinforce North America’s leading market position.

Europe Electric Blanket Market Analysis:

Europe represents a significant regional market for electric blankets, supported by cold and temperate climate conditions across a substantial portion of the continent, particularly in Northern and Central European countries such as the United Kingdom, Germany, Scandinavia, and the Benelux region. European consumers demonstrate strong awareness of energy efficiency and environmental sustainability, making the shift from central heating to targeted electric warming solutions a practical and responsible choice in many households. According to reports, the European Commission launched the “Save Energy” campaign encouraging households across the European Union to reduce heating energy consumption during winter by adopting more efficient and targeted warming practices. The region also benefits from a well-established retail ecosystem that spans both traditional brick-and-mortar outlets and advanced e-commerce platforms, ensuring broad product availability. Stringent safety and electrical standards across European markets have encouraged manufacturers to invest in quality certifications and compliance measures, thereby building consumer confidence in electric blanket safety. Asia-Pacific Electric Blanket Market Analysis:

Asia-Pacific is emerging as a rapidly growing regional market for electric blankets, supported by climatic diversity and evolving consumer lifestyles across key economies such as China, Japan, South Korea, and Australia. Countries in the northeastern portion of the region, including Japan and South Korea, have well-established traditions of personal heating solutions and represent significant consumer bases for electric blankets. The rapid expansion of urban middle-class populations across China and emerging Southeast Asian economies is creating new demand for affordable home comfort products. Increasing digitization of retail channels and the growth of regional e-commerce platforms have substantially improved product accessibility. Growing awareness of energy-efficient alternatives to traditional space heating further supports market development in the region, particularly as consumers in colder climate zones seek cost-effective personal warming solutions for residential use.

Latin America Electric Blanket Market Analysis:

Latin America represents a developing market for electric blankets, with demand concentrated in higher-altitude and southern regions of countries such as Argentina, Chile, and Brazil, where winter temperatures create genuine consumer need for personal warming products. Rising urbanization and improving household incomes across the region are expanding the middle-class consumer base and increasing accessibility to home comfort products. The growing penetration of online retail channels in Latin America is facilitating greater product discoverability and purchase convenience for consumers in previously underserved markets. Seasonal marketing efforts aligned with winter months continue to drive periodic demand peaks across the region’s major economies.

Middle East and Africa Electric Blanket Market Analysis:

The Middle East and Africa market for electric blankets remains at a nascent stage of development but holds potential in cooler climate zones, including elevated regions and desert areas that experience significant temperature drops during nighttime and winter months. Countries such as South Africa, Morocco, and parts of the Gulf Cooperation Council states with cooler highland zones represent the primary demand centers. Increasing urbanization, rising household incomes, and the growing influence of international retail brands are gradually improving market awareness and product availability. The adoption of e-commerce and cross-border retail platforms is expected to play a key role in expanding consumer access across the region.

Competitive Landscape:

The global electric blanket market is characterized by moderate to high competition, with established manufacturers focusing on product safety, energy efficiency, and technological integration to differentiate their offerings. Key players are investing in research and development to introduce smart connectivity features, advanced heating wire technologies, and eco-friendly materials that meet the evolving preferences of health-conscious and environmentally aware consumers. Product recalls and stringent safety regulations in major markets present notable challenges for manufacturers, necessitating continuous compliance investment. Companies are also expanding their distribution footprints through e-commerce platforms and specialty retail partnerships to reach a broader consumer base. Competitive strategies increasingly emphasize branding, warranty programs, and customer education to build trust in a product category where safety remains a primary purchase consideration.

Latest News and Developments:

  • In October 2025, Xiaomi launched the Mijia Smart Electric Blanket in China featuring 80W heating elements, smartphone app connectivity, and Xiao AI voice controls. The product also includes smart sleep mode, temperature scheduling, mite-removal functionality, and multiple safety protections, reflecting growing demand for connected smart-home heating products.
     
  • In September 2025, Dunelm launched the Teddy Electric Throw in the United Kingdom, featuring a soft teddy-fleece texture and adjustable heating settings. The heated blanket is machine washable and designed to provide quick warmth, reflecting rising seasonal demand for convenient home heating and electric bedding products across European households.
